Yard. An open space on the same lot with a building, which open space is <br /> unoccupied and unobstructed from the ground upward, except as otherwise permitted in <br /> Article 32. <br /> . Yard, Front. A yard extending across the full width of the front of the lot and <br /> measured from the front line of the lot toward the nearest line of the building. <br /> . Yard, Rear. Except as otherwise provided in this article, a yard extending <br /> across the full width of the lot, adjacent to the rear lot line, and measured from the rear line <br /> of the lot towards the main building. <br /> . Yard, Side. A yard measured from the side line of the lot toward the interior of <br /> the lotand extendingfromthe requiredfrontyardtothe required rearyard, orrearlot line if <br /> no rearyard is required. <br /> . Zoning Administrator. The Planning Director of the City of Redwood City, or <br /> the designee of the Planning Director. <br /> Example Diagram (Sec. 2.51) <br /> Height of Residential Structures on Sloping lots <br />
